Red Flag #1: Vague or Missing Certifications

Certifications are the bedrock of product safety and compliance. A reliable switch manufacturer will clearly display relevant certifications such as BS 1363 for UK markets, IEC standards, CE marking, or UL listing. If a supplier cannot provide documentation or offers evasive answers about their certification status, consider it a major red flag.

Red Flag #2: Poor Communication and Lack of Transparency

During initial inquiries, observe how the manufacturer communicates. Do they respond promptly? Are they willing to answer technical questions? A reliable switch manufacturer should have knowledgeable sales and technical support teams. Red flags include vague responses, long delays, or a reluctance to discuss manufacturing processes or materials.

Transparency extends to pricing, lead times, and shipping terms. If a supplier is unclear about these basics, it may indicate disorganization or an intention to change terms later. Red Flag #3: No Factory Audit or Visit Opportunity

A trustworthy manufacturer welcomes factory audits, either in person or via video call. If a supplier refuses or makes excuses, it is a significant warning sign. Factory visits allow you to assess production capacity, quality control measures, and working conditions. Without this insight, you are essentially buying blind.

Red Flag #4: Unusually Low Prices or Unrealistic Promises

While competitive pricing is attractive, extremely low prices often indicate substandard materials or labor. A reliable switch manufacturer invests in quality components, rigorous testing, and skilled workers. If a quote is significantly lower than industry averages, ask what cost-saving measures are in place. Common shortcuts include using recycled plastics, thinner copper contacts, or omitting safety features.

Similarly, be wary of promises that seem too good to be true, such as instant delivery of large orders or lifetime warranties without clear terms. Green Light #1: Comprehensive Product Testing and Quality Control

A reliable switch manufacturer conducts thorough testing at multiple stages of production. Look for evidence of in-house testing labs, third-party testing partnerships, and adherence to standards like BS 1363, IEC 60884, or UL 498. Green lights include sharing test reports, offering samples for evaluation, and having clear quality control documentation.

Before approving an order, turn the requirements discussed above into a written purchase specification. Record the target market, applicable standard, rated voltage and current, materials, dimensions, terminal design, packaging, labeling, sample approval method, inspection level, and documents required before shipment. Ask the supplier to identify any assumptions or exceptions in writing. Keep an approved sample and revision-controlled drawing as the reference for production and final inspection. This process does not replace certification or local engineering review, but it gives buyers and suppliers a shared checklist and reduces avoidable misunderstandings during quoting, sampling, production, and delivery.

Rigorous Quality Control from Raw Material to Finished Product

Quality consistency is critical for OEM partners who supply to contractors, retailers, and specifiers. MORDIO implements multi-stage quality control that covers every step of production:

  • Incoming inspection of thermoplastics, brass contacts, and steel components against defined specifications.
  • In-process checks during injection molding, stamping, and assembly to detect deviations early.
  • Final testing of each batch for electrical safety (dielectric strength, insulation resistance) and mechanical durability (plug insertion/withdrawal cycles).
  • Random sampling for accelerated aging and environmental stress tests.

Compliance requirements vary by product classification, destination country, importer role, intended use, and date. Treat standards and marks mentioned in this article as research starting points rather than legal advice or a complete market-entry checklist. Before approving production or packaging, obtain written confirmation of the current requirements from the responsible authority, an accredited conformity-assessment body, or a qualified local compliance professional. Confirm the exact product model, applicable standard edition, required tests, permitted marks, technical-file contents, labeling, registration, importer obligations, and customs documents.
